A rapid paper-disc test for penicillinase.

K K Tu, J H Jorgensen, C W Stratton

    American Journal of Clinical Pathology
    |April 1, 1981
    PubMed
    Summary

    A new paper disc assay detects penicillinase production by bacteria. This simple, rapid method uses penicillin and phenol red to indicate enzyme activity through a color change.

    Background:

    • Penicillinase is an enzyme produced by some bacteria that confers resistance to penicillin antibiotics.
    • Accurate and rapid detection of penicillinase is crucial for effective antibiotic treatment and infection control.
    • Existing methods for detecting penicillinase may be time-consuming or require specialized equipment.

    Purpose of the Study:

    • To develop a practical and accessible acidimetric assay for the detection of penicillinase production.
    • To create a simple, rapid, and accurate method for identifying penicillinase-producing bacteria.

    Main Methods:

    • Paper discs were impregnated with buffered penicillin G and 1% phenol red.
    • Discs were incubated with bacterial suspensions in saline solution.
    • Visual detection of a yellow color change within 1–30 minutes indicated a positive result.

    Main Results:

    • The developed assay successfully detected penicillinase production in bacterial strains.
    • A distinct yellow color change was observed within 1 to 30 minutes for penicillinase-positive samples.
    • The assay demonstrated simplicity, rapidity, and accuracy when tested against Staphylococcus aureus, Haemophilus influenzae, and Neisseria gonorrhoeae.

    Conclusions:

    • A practical and effective paper disc-based assay for penicillinase detection has been established.
    • This method offers a simple, rapid, and accurate approach for identifying penicillinase-producing bacteria in clinical and research settings.
    • The assay's ease of use and quick results make it a valuable tool for microbiology diagnostics.
